Показать сообщение отдельно
  #3  
Старый 18.06.2010, 08:17
Rjkzy Rjkzy вне форума
Прохожий
 
Регистрация: 15.06.2010
Адрес: дома
Сообщения: 34
Репутация: 10
По умолчанию

в принципе всё то же самое, только с "выдёргиванием" текста. хотя я если честно не понял, зачем его выдёргивать нужно, когда мы его же и ищём
Код:
procedure TForm1.Button1Click(Sender: TObject);
var
c:Cardinal;
begin

c:=pos(Edit1.Text,Memo1.Text);
if c<>0 then
  begin
  Label1.Font.Color:=clBlue;
  Label1.Caption:=Copy(Memo1.Text,c,length(Edit1.Text));
  end
else
  begin
  Label1.Font.Color:=clRed;
  Label1.Caption:='Текст не найден';
  end;
end;
Ответить с цитированием